Comment by Bernard Shaw on Reeve and the Fabians. Though one of the parts of the earth best fitted for man New Zealand was probably about the last of such lands occupied by the human race. The first European to find it was a Dutch sea-captain who was looking for something else and who thought it a part of South America from which it is sundered by five thousand miles of ocean.
